Saad comes off the books and they will look to find a trade partners for guys like Kadri, Donskoi and/or Compher. The Avs will make it work. Real good front office in Colorado.

They can make it work, but with so many teams against the cap they are going to have to take something back in those trades. The biggest problem they face is 2/3rds of the league have less than 1M in cap space, Carolina has the 27th most amount of cap space and they have $2M. There is nowhere to dump salary because the bottom 4 teams aren't likely to be interested in those guys. I'd flip out if the Kings traded for one of those guys unless a 2022 first was coming along with them. The cap is flat and the teams that would be interested in those players have no way to absorb their contracts. I see no reason for EJ to waive, but where could they send him? Who is going to take that contract? It's more likely they buy him out for the $2M penalty.

They are up against it even with Saad off the books. They are at 58M with for 12 guys next year, the only goalie signed is the recovering Francouz. If they get Landeskog/Makar for 15M they've done a good job, the saving grace for them is teams don't have a lot of money to throw at UFAs. Still, that's 73M for 14, with Grubauer a UFA and 4 other RFAs, including Jost.

Real good front office, but they have their work cut out. I think there is a real fear of losing GL which is why they loaded up this year.
